p{
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 12px;
        color: #530404;
        text-align: left;
        margin-left:3px;
        margin-right:20px;
        line-height: 20px;
}
.texttypes{
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 12px;
        color: #530404;
        text-align: left;
}


.clear{
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 12px;
        color: #ffffff;
        text-align: left;
        margin-left:10px;
        margin-right:20px;
        margin-top:10px;
        line-height: 20px;
        font-weight: bold;

}
.zit{
        font-style: italic;
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 12px;
        color: #530404;
        text-align: left;
        margin-left:3px;
        margin-top:15px;

        line-height: 20px;


}
.bolder{
        font-weight: bold;
        font-size: 12px;
        color: #530404;
}
.serv{

        line-height: 12px;
        font-weight: bold;
        font-size: 12px;
        color: #530404;
}
.gross{
        font-style: italic;
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 14px;
        color: #530404;
        text-align: left;
        margin-left:3px;
        margin-right:20px;
        line-height: 20px;


}
.right{
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 10px;
        color: #530404;
        text-align: right;


}


.ad{
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 10px;
        color: #530404;
        text-align: right;
        margin-left:0px;
        margin-right:0px;

}




form,input,select,textarea{
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 10px;
        color: #3D3D3E;
        text-align: left;
        margin-top:2px;
        margin-left:0px;


}


.headline{
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 13px;
        color: #FFFFFF;
        text-align: left;
        margin-top:5px;
        margin-left:3px;
        line-height: 1,5;
        font-weight: bold;

}










.namen{
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 10px;
        color: #DEE3E7;
        text-align: left;
        margin-top:2px;
        margin-left:3px;


}



.black{
        font-weight: bold;
        font-size: 16px;
        color: #000000;
}
h1{
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-weight: bold;
        color: #530404;
        text-align: left;
        font-size: 14px;
        margin-left:3px;
        margin-right:20px;
        line-height:10px;
}


h2{
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-weight: bold;
        color: #ffffff;
        text-align: left;
        font-size: 14px;
        font-style : normal;
                margin-left:3px;
}

.dark{

        color: #56595C;

}


.bold{
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 11px;
        color: #56595C;
        text-align: left;
        margin-top:20px;
        font-weight: bold;
}











}
.blue{

        color: #00649C;

}


td, th, tr{
        font-size : 8pt;
        font-style : normal;
        font-weight : normal;
        color: #FFFFFF;
        }
Ol,li,{
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 12px;
        color: #ffffff;
        text-align: left;
        margin-top:-3px;
        margin-left:3px;
  line-height: 0,1;

}
/* -----------------------------Links---------------------------------- */


a:link{
        color : #530404;
        text-decoration : none;

        }


/* Verweise zu bereits besuchten Seiten */
a:visited{
        color : #530404;
        text-decoration : none;
        }


/* Verweise, während der Anwender mit der Maus darüber fährt */
a:hover{
        color : #530404;
        text-decoration : none;
        }


/* gerade angeklickte Verweise */
a:active{
        color : #530404;
        text-decoration : none;
        }

.on{

color : #0099FF;

}



/* -----------------------------subnavi links---------------------------------- */


.unter:link{
                color : #626469;
                text-decoration : underline;
                font-size: 12px;
                font-family: Verdana, Arial, Helvetica, sans-serif;
                line-height: 0,1;
                margin-top:-3px;
        }

.unter:visited{
                color : #530404;
                text-decoration : underline;
                font-size: 12px;
                font-family: Verdana, Arial, Helvetica, sans-serif;
                line-height: 0,1;
                margin-top:-3px;
        }

.unter:hover{
                color : #530404;
                text-decoration : underline;
                font-size: 12px;
                font-family: Verdana, Arial, Helvetica, sans-serif;
                font-weight: bold;
                line-height: 0,1;
                margin-top:-3px;
        }

.unter:active{
                color : #530404;
                text-decoration : underline;
                font-size: 12px;
                font-family: Verdana, Arial, Helvetica, sans-serif;

                line-height: 0,1;
                margin-top:-3px;
        }



.rahmen{
        BORDER-RIGHT: #ffffff 1px solid;
        BORDER-LEFT: #ffffff 1px solid;
        BORDER-BOTTOM: #ffffff 1px solid;
        BORDER-TOP: #ffffff 1px solid;
}
/* -----------------------------Links-Adresse---------------------------------- */
.adresse:link{
        color : #00649C;
        text-decoration :  none;
        }
.adresse:visited{
        color : #00649C;
        text-decoration :  none;


        }
.adresse:hover{
        color : #ffffff;
        text-decoration :  none;

        }
.adresse:active{
        color : #ffffff;
        text-decoration : none;

        }






.adress{

        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 13px;
        font-weight:bold;
        color: #626469;
        text-align: right;
        margin-left:200px;

        margin-top:0px;
        line-height: 22px;


}



/*body {
        scrollbar-shadow-color: #56595C;
        scrollbar-face-color: #B8BAB9;
        scrollbar-base-color: #56595C;
        scrollbar-highlight-color: #999999;
        scrollbar-3dlight-color: #56595C;
        scrollbar-darkshadow-color: #A4A6A8;
        scrollbar-track-color: #B8BAB9;
        scrollbar-arrow-color: #56595C;

}
*/


.pfeil {
        scrollbar-shadow-color: #75171A;
        scrollbar-face-color: #ffffff;
        scrollbar-base-color: #75171A;
        scrollbar-highlight-color: #75171A;
        scrollbar-3dlight-color: #FFFFFF;
        scrollbar-darkshadow-color: #FFFFFF;
        scrollbar-track-color: #FFFFFF;
        scrollbar-arrow-color: #530404

}











#layervorlage{
        position:absolute;
        top:45%;
        left:50%;
        width:780px;
        height:460px;
        margin-left:-390px;
        margin-top:-230px;
        z-index: 0;


}



#layercontent {
        position: absolute;
        z-index: 2;
        height: 415px;
        width: 639px;
        left: 130px;
        top: 73px;

        overflow: auto;
        BORDER-RIGHT: #75171A 1px solid;
        BORDER-LEFT: #75171A 1px solid;
        BORDER-BOTTOM: #75171A 1px solid;
        BORDER-TOP: #75171A 1px solid;

}




#adresse {
        position: absolute;
        z-index: 2;
        height: 10px;
        width: 760px;
        left: 10px;
        top: 490px;

}

#headline {
        position: absolute;
        z-index: 3;
        height: 27px;
        width: 490px;
        left: 155px;
        top: 111px;
        overflow: auto;

}

#text {
        position: absolute;
        z-index: 3;
        height: 320px;
        width: 613px;
        left: 155px;
        top: 168px;
        overflow: auto;


}


#port {
        position: absolute;
        z-index: 4;
        height: 122px;
        width: 151px;
        left: 160px;
        top: 351px;
        filter: Alpha(finishx=100,startx=70, style=1);

}

#port2 {
        position: absolute;
        z-index: 4;
        height: 250px;
        width: 300px;
        left: 650px;
        top: 203px;

       filter:Alpha(opacity=100, finishopacity=0, style=2);
}

#logo {
        position: absolute;
        z-index: 3;
        height: 128px;
        width: 188px;
        left: 591px;
        top: 36px;
        overflow: auto;

}

#leiste {
        position: absolute;
        z-index: 1;
        height: 296px;
        width: 170px;
        left: 0px;
        top: 195px;
        background-image : url(../images/buchhg.jpg);
        overflow: auto;

}

#bloom {
        position: absolute;
        z-index: 1;
        height: 188px;
        width: 264px;
        left: 0px;
        top: 0px;
        overflow: auto;
}
#journalismus{
        position: absolute;
        z-index: 2;
        height: 14px;
        width: 63px;
        left: 0px;
        top: 117px;

}
#oeffentlichkeitsarbeit{
        position: absolute;
        z-index: 2;
        height: 14px;
        width: 63px;
        left: 0px;
        top: 144px;
}
#reden{
        position: absolute;
        z-index: 2;
        height: 14px;
        width: 63px;
        left: 0px;
        top: 171px;
}
#trauerreden{
        position: absolute;
        z-index: 2;
        height: 16px;
        width: 125px;
        left: 0px;
        top: 198px;
}
#biografien{
        position: absolute;
        z-index: 2;
        height: 14px;
        width: 112px;
        left: 0px;
        top: 225px;
}
#uebermich{
        position: absolute;
        z-index: 2;
        height: 16px;
        width: 125px;
        left: 0px;
        top: 252px;
}
#impressum{
        position: absolute;
        z-index: 2;
        height: 14px;
        width: 112px;
        left: 0px;
        top: 279px;
}
#index{
        position: absolute;
        z-index: 2;
        height: 14px;
        width: 104px;
        left: 0px;
        top: 306px;
}

.trans {
   overflow:hidden;
}





.opal{

 filter:Alpha(opacity=50, finishopacity=0, style=1)


}
.opal1{

 filter:Alpha(opacity=40, finishopacity=0, style=1)


}
.opal3{

 filter:Alpha(opacity=70, finishopacity=0, style=3)


}